ASC 820-10-35-24A (FASB) identifies three approaches to measuring fair value: market, income, and cost. It instructs practitioners to maximize observable inputs and minimize unobservable ones, and it permits multiple approaches when no single method is conclusive. For U.S. liquidation assignments, ASC 820 is the governing standard for fair-value measurement; any valuation used in financial reporting, lending, or court proceedings must conform to it.
The International Valuation Standards (IVS) complement ASC 820 by defining bases of value more granularly: market value, investment value, synergistic value, and liquidation value. The IVS distinction between orderly and forced liquidation premises is particularly consequential. An orderly liquidation assumes a reasonable marketing period; a forced liquidation assumes a compressed timeline, which materially lowers estimated recoverable values.
Valuation assignments should disclose the basis of value, premise of value, and primary inputs in the report. That disclosure is not optional under ASC 820 or IVS — it is what makes a conclusion defensible to lenders, courts, and buyers.

Use DCF when the asset or business unit generates predictable, attributable cash flows — a leased manufacturing facility, a contracted processing line, or a going-concern segment being carved out. In a forced-liquidation scenario, DCF is rarely the primary method, but it remains a useful cross-check and a ceiling on value. Damodaran’s model-selection guidance is direct: match the model to the asset’s financial reality, and shift away from going-concern DCF when the sale premise is distressed.

The market approach is primary when recent, comparable transaction data exist — same-model equipment sold at auction, brokered plant-component sales, or industry database records. Investopedia’s asset valuation guidance describes the income approach’s DCF mechanics, but for physical industrial assets, market evidence often carries more weight because it reflects what buyers actually paid under real conditions.

Reliable data sources for U.S. industrial equipment include specialized auction platforms, industry broker sale records, internal historical sale records, and trade-specific transaction databases. The primary limitation of the market approach is comparability. Custom-built or highly specialized equipment may have no true comparable. In those cases, the cost approach becomes the anchor, and market evidence serves only as a directional check.
The cost approach estimates what a market participant would pay to replace the asset’s service capacity today, then deducts for obsolescence. Per ASC 820, the cost approach “reflects the amount that would be required currently to replace the service capacity of an asset (often referred to as current replacement cost)” and requires consideration of physical deterioration, functional obsolescence, and economic obsolescence. For liquidation purposes, this figure represents a floor: a rational buyer will not pay more than replacement cost, net of depreciation.

The cost approach mechanics are particularly well-suited to property, plant, and equipment where comparables are thin and cash flow attribution is difficult.
PwC’s guidance on valuation synthesis is clear: multiple approaches act as a check on assumptions and inputs, and the final conclusion should reflect the most representative point within the range of indicated values. Damodaran reinforces this — model selection should follow data availability and asset characteristics, not habit.
The decision rules are straightforward. Use the market approach as primary when comparable transaction data are available and reliable. Shift to the income approach as primary when the asset generates observable, attributable cash flows under a going-concern premise. Default to the cost approach as primary for custom-built or specialized equipment where comparables are scarce and cash flow attribution is unreliable.
| Approach | Primary inputs | Typical use in liquidation | Key strength | Common error |
|---|---|---|---|---|
| Market | Comparable transaction prices, condition adjustments | Common equipment with active resale markets | Reflects actual buyer behavior | Poor comparability for specialized assets |
| Income (DCF) | Projected cash flows, discount rate, terminal value | Going-concern segments, income-producing assets | Captures future earning potential | Overstated cash flows under liquidation premise |
| Cost (Replacement) | Replacement cost, obsolescence adjustments, disposal costs | Specialized plant, custom equipment, floor value | Defensible floor; works without comparables | Underestimates synergistic or bundled value |
For an orderly liquidation of common equipment, a typical weighting gives the greatest emphasis to the market approach, with meaningful contributions from the cost approach and a smaller role for income. For a forced liquidation of specialized plant, the cost approach carries the most weight, followed by market and income approaches. These weightings must be documented and justified in the report, not applied mechanically.
Preparing clear documentation and condition reporting materially increases valuation accuracy and buyer confidence. Buyers discount heavily for uncertainty; every gap in documentation becomes a negotiating point that reduces net proceeds.
On the refurbishment question: minor cleaning, lubrication, and operational testing typically return more than their cost in buyer confidence. Major refurbishment rarely recovers its investment in a liquidation timeline. Insist on a written report that states the basis and premise of value, the methods used, all primary inputs, and sensitivity ranges. A verbal opinion or a one-page summary is not sufficient for lender approval, legal proceedings, or board-level sale authorization.
Red flags include undisclosed key inputs, single-method reliance without cross-checks, missing sensitivity analysis, and comparable transactions that cannot be independently verified. The IVS requirement that liquidation value disclose marketing period assumptions and disposal costs is a minimum standard, not a ceiling. The most consistent lesson from industrial liquidations is that valuation defensibility and buyer behavior are inseparable. Buyers discount aggressively when they cannot verify inputs — not because they doubt the asset’s physical condition, but because an undocumented valuation signals that the seller has not done the work to support a higher price. The second lesson is that the liquidation premise must be set before the valuation begins, not after. Sellers who commission a going-concern DCF and then pivot to a forced-sale timeline find that their valuation provides no cover for the price they actually receive.
